I have a guest booked today and did not show up , also did not pay it. Would you help me ? Please

Go into Extranet, select the booking in question and find the No-show selection on the right hand side.

Use this and, if you are normally paid by the guest at the property, select "waive fees" to avoid BDC charging you commission. You will not get paid for this reservation. It is best to change your policies to payment in advance, using a third party payment system, then adjusting your refund policy so that a no show does not get a refund and cancellations can only be refunded if cancelled ahead of time, a duration of your choosing, or not at all.

How can I block some countries I dont want to receive reservations from?

Blocking countries wouldn't be an option with Booking.com as it'd be considered as discriminating and it'd be conflicting with our aim to be inclusive towards everyone.

 

If there is a guest misbehavior you've experienced, I'd like to kindly suggest to report the case by following this procedure instead.
